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Oreo Cookies: These are the star of the show! If you’re looking for a gluten-free option, try using gluten-free sandwich cookies instead. They’re just as delicious and will work well in this recipe.

White Chocolate Chips: I prefer using high-quality white chocolate chips as they melt beautifully and taste great. If you can’t find chips, you can use melting wafers, which are easy to work with and come in various colors, too!

Coconut Oil: This ingredient is optional but helps make the chocolate smoother. You can also use vegetable oil as a substitute, or simply skip it if you want a thicker coating.

Sprinkles: While pink, purple, and white sprinkles are fun, you can use any colors that match your theme or occasion. Mix it up with seasonal sprinkles for holidays or parties!

Food Coloring: Adding a touch of color is optional but can really make your treats pop! Gel food coloring works best as it doesn’t alter the consistency of the chocolate.

How Do I Melt White Chocolate Perfectly?

Melted white chocolate can be tricky if you’re not careful. Here’s a step-by-step to get it right:

  • Start with a microwave-safe bowl. Add your white chocolate chips and coconut oil (if using).
  • Heat in 30-second intervals on medium power, stirring after each interval. This prevents overheating.
  • Keep heating until the chocolate is just melted but still thick. Remove it from the microwave before it gets too hot to avoid seizing.

These tips help achieve a smooth and creamy chocolate that coats the Oreos perfectly. Remember, patience is key!

How to Make White Chocolate Covered Oreos

Ingredients You’ll Need:

For the Dipped Oreos:

  • 1 package Oreo cookies (about 30 cookies)
  • 2 cups white chocolate chips (or melting wafers)
  • 1 tablespoon coconut oil (optional for smoother melting)

For Decoration:

  • Assorted sprinkles (pink, purple, white, and heart shapes)
  • Food coloring (pink or red, optional for drizzling)

How Much Time Will You Need?

The total time for this recipe is about 1 hour. This includes 10 minutes for preparation, 30 minutes for the chocolate to set, and a few minutes for melting and dipping the Oreos. It’s a fun and simple process, perfect for a sweet treat!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are a Baking Sheet:

First, grab a baking sheet and line it with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. This is where your dipped Oreos will go to set, so make sure it’s ready before you start dipping!

2. Melt the White Chocolate:

In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the white chocolate chips and coconut oil (if you’re using it). Heat in the microwave for 30 seconds at a time. After each interval, take the bowl out and stir the chocolate. Keep heating until everything is melted and smooth.

3. Dip the Oreos:

Grab a fork and dip each Oreo cookie into the melted white chocolate. Make sure each cookie is fully coated. Let any extra chocolate drip back into the bowl before moving on to the next step.

4. Place on the Baking Sheet:

Carefully lay the dipped Oreos onto your prepared baking sheet. Repeat this until all of your Oreos are coated in chocolate. They’ll look so tasty already!

5. Add Sprinkles:

While the white chocolate is still wet, sprinkle your assorted decorations over each dipped Oreo. This step is where you can get creative with your designs!

6. Optional Drizzle:

If you want to add a colorful drizzle, mix a little food coloring into some of the remaining melted white chocolate. Use a fork or a spoon to drizzle this colored chocolate over the dipped Oreos for that extra pop of color!

7. Set the Chocolate:

Now, let the Oreos s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es until the chocolate is fully set. If you’re in a hurry, you can pop them in the fridge for quicker setting.

8. Serve and Enjoy:

Once the chocolate is firm, plate your delightful white chocolate covered Oreos. They make a fantastic sweet treat or a lovely gift for friends and family. Enjoy your delicious creation!

Can I Use Dark or Milk Chocolate Instead of White Chocolate?

Absolutely! Feel free to substitute dark or milk chocolate chips or wafers for a different flavor profile. Just note that you may need to adjust the melting time, as different chocolates have varying melting points. Stir frequently to achieve a smooth consistency.

How Do I Store Leftover Covered Oreos?

Store your white chocolate covered Oreos in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you live in a warmer climate, consider refrigerating them for longer freshness, just be sure to separate layers with parchment paper to prevent sticking!

What Other Decorations Can I Use?

The possibilities are endless! Consider using crushed nuts, mini candies, or even edible glitter for a fun twist. You can also match the decorations to the occasion for a personalized touch!
